To the Powers That Be,
Star Trek Online is a game with promise that is clearly getting a lot of love in the community as well as on this site.
I love it, my mates love it, and it should find a home here where we can geek out and enjoy this game by sharing its brilliance with others.
Please, please make STO a featured game as I know you will have legions of players looking to make meaningful contributions to content for the site.
Cheers,
Z